Загрузка файла размером более 4МБ приводит к ошибке

Если при попытке загрузить файл размером больше 4 МБ возникает ошибка и ничего не происходит, это может быть связано с ограничением размера файла, установленным на сервере. В таких случаях необходимо проверить настройки сервера, а также возможные ограничения на загрузку файлов в системе управления контентом (CMS) или настройках плагина загрузки файлов.

Следующие разделы статьи будут рассматривать возможные причины и решения этой проблемы, а также предоставят инструкции по изменению настроек сервера, CMS и плагинов, чтобы позволить загружать файлы размером больше 4 МБ. Также будет рассмотрено, как проверить текущие ограничения на размер файлов и какие последствия могут возникнуть при изменении этих настроек.

Проблема с загрузкой файлов больше 4МБ

Загрузка файлов на веб-сайт является обычным и неотъемлемым элементом многих интернет-ресурсов. Однако, иногда пользователи сталкиваются с проблемой, когда попытка загрузить файл размером более 4МБ заканчивается неудачей. В этой статье мы рассмотрим причины возникновения данной проблемы и возможные решения.

Причины возникновения проблемы

  • Ограничения сервера: Некоторые серверы имеют ограничения на размер загружаемых файлов. Одна из самых распространенных ограничений — это ограничение на размер файла в 4МБ. Когда пользователь пытается загрузить файл, превышающий это ограничение, сервер отклоняет запрос и возвращает ошибку.
  • Ограничения браузера: Некоторые браузеры также имеют ограничения на размер загружаемых файлов. Это может быть связано с ограничениями памяти или ограничениями безопасности. Когда пользователь пытается загрузить файл, превышающий это ограничение, браузер отклоняет запрос и возвращает ошибку.
  • Проблемы с сетью: Иногда проблемы с загрузкой файлов могут быть вызваны проблемами сети. Недостаточная скорость или неполадки в сети могут привести к неудачным попыткам загрузки файлов большого размера.

Возможные решения

Существует несколько способов решить проблему с загрузкой файлов размером более 4МБ:

  • Свяжитесь с веб-хостинг-провайдером: Если проблема связана с ограничениями сервера, вам следует обратиться к вашему веб-хостинг-провайдеру и узнать о возможности увеличения лимитов на размер загружаемых файлов.
  • Измените настройки браузера: Если проблема связана с ограничениями браузера, вы можете попробовать изменить настройки браузера или воспользоваться другим браузером, который не имеет таких ограничений.
  • Проверьте соединение с интернетом: Если проблема связана с сетью, убедитесь, что у вас надежное и стабильное соединение с интернетом. Если возникают проблемы со скоростью, попробуйте загрузить файл в другое время или воспользуйтесь более быстрым интернет-соединением.

Всегда стоит помнить, что загрузка файлов большего размера может занимать больше времени, особенно при использовании медленного интернет-соединения. Если возникают проблемы с загрузкой, вам следует быть терпеливым и дождаться завершения процесса загрузки.

Файл слишком велик для конечной файловой системы что делать?

Что происходит, когда файл больше 4МБ?

Когда вы пытаетесь загрузить файл, который превышает размер 4МБ, могут возникнуть различные проблемы. Эти проблемы связаны с ограничениями на размер файла, которые могут быть установлены на сервере, а также с ограничениями, установленными на вашем устройстве.

Во-первых, когда вы пытаетесь загрузить файл, сервер может иметь ограничение на максимальный размер файла, который может быть загружен. Это ограничение может быть установлено администратором сервера, чтобы предотвратить перегрузку сервера и сохранить его производительность. Если ваш файл превышает это ограничение, сервер может отказать в загрузке файла и выдаст ошибку.

Во-вторых, ваше устройство (например, компьютер или мобильное устройство) также может иметь ограничение на размер файла, который может быть загружен. Это ограничение может быть установлено операционной системой или программой, которую вы используете для загрузки файла. Если файл превышает это ограничение, ваше устройство может отказаться загружать файл или просто не сможет обработать такой большой файл.

В некоторых случаях, если вы не можете загрузить файл больше 4МБ, вы можете попробовать использовать другой способ загрузки файла или разделить файл на несколько более мелких частей и загрузить их по отдельности.

Ограничение размера файла

Ограничение размера файла является важным аспектом при загрузке файлов на веб-сайт. Оно определяет максимальный размер файла, который можно загрузить на сервер.

Ограничение размера файла обычно устанавливается для обеспечения безопасности и оптимизации работы сервера. Безопасность — потому что большие файлы могут потребовать больших объемов памяти и ресурсов сервера, что может повлиять на производительность и доступность других пользователей. Оптимизация — потому что ограничение размера файла позволяет контролировать объем данных, которые могут быть переданы и обработаны сервером.

Ограничение размера файла на стороне клиента

Ограничение размера файла на стороне клиента контролируется с помощью атрибута «accept» в теге <input type=»file»>. Этот атрибут позволяет указать MIME-типы файлов, которые могут быть загружены, и ограничить их размеры. Но следует помнить, что это ограничение может быть обойдено злоумышленниками, поэтому основная проверка размера файла должна выполняться на стороне сервера.

Ограничение размера файла на стороне сервера

Ограничение размера файла на стороне сервера устанавливается в конфигурационных файлах сервера или на уровне программного кода приложения. Веб-серверы, такие как Apache и Nginx, имеют конфигурационные параметры, позволяющие установить максимальный размер загружаемых файлов. Программы на языках программирования, таких как PHP или Node.js, также предоставляют средства для контроля размера загружаемых файлов.

Обработка ошибки при превышении ограничения размера файла

Если пользователь пытается загрузить файл, размер которого превышает установленное ограничение, сервер должен обработать эту ситуацию и вернуть соответствующую ошибку. Ошибки могут быть представлены с помощью статусных кодов HTTP, таких как «413 Request Entity Too Large» или «500 Internal Server Error». Кроме того, сервер может предоставлять пользователю информацию о причинах ошибки и инструкции для исправления ситуации.

Почему существует ограничение в 4МБ?

Ограничение в 4МБ на загрузку файлов имеет свои объяснения и основания. Следует понимать, что это ограничение является стандартным ограничением, установленным во многих веб-приложениях и платформах.

Существуют несколько причин, почему ограничение в 4МБ может быть установлено. Вот некоторые из них:

  1. Ограничения на сервере: Веб-серверы могут иметь ограничения на размер загружаемых файлов, чтобы предотвратить перегрузку или отказ в обслуживании. Размеры файлов исходящего трафика также нужно учитывать при выборе хостинг-провайдера. Ограничение в 4МБ обычно считается разумным балансом между возможностью загрузки достаточно больших файлов и предотвращением проблем с производительностью сервера.

  2. Пропускная способность сети: Веб-приложения часто работают в сетевых окружениях с ограниченной пропускной способностью. Это означает, что загрузка и скачивание больших файлов может занять значительное время. Ограничение в 4МБ помогает снизить время загрузки и улучшить общую производительность приложения для множества пользователей.

  3. Безопасность: Ограничение в 4МБ также может быть установлено для защиты от возможных уязвимостей веб-приложений. Загрузка больших файлов может повлечь за собой риск для безопасности и злоумышленник может использовать это для атаки на сервер или выполнения вредоносного кода. Ограничение в 4МБ помогает уменьшить потенциальные угрозы и повышает безопасность приложения.

Какое ограничение устанавливается на разных платформах?

Загрузка файлов большого размера может столкнуться с ограничениями, которые устанавливаются на разных платформах. Эти ограничения могут варьироваться в зависимости от операционной системы или серверного программного обеспечения.

Ограничения на сервере

Серверы, которые принимают файлы от пользователей, могут иметь ограничения на размер загружаемых файлов. Эти ограничения устанавливаются для оптимизации работы сервера и предотвращения перегрузки. Например, на некоторых серверах может быть установлено ограничение в 4 МБ для загрузки файлов.

Ограничения на сервере могут быть настроены администратором и могут быть разными для каждого конкретного сервера. Это означает, что один сервер может позволять загружать файлы до 10 МБ, тогда как другой сервер может иметь ограничение в 2 МБ.

Ограничения на клиенте

Также стоит учитывать ограничения на стороне клиента, то есть на компьютере пользователя или на мобильном устройстве. Некоторые операционные системы или веб-браузеры могут иметь ограничения на размер загружаемых файлов.

Например, веб-браузер Google Chrome может иметь ограничение в 2 ГБ на загружаемый файл, в то время как веб-браузер Firefox может иметь ограничение в 5 ГБ. Ограничения могут также варьироваться в зависимости от версии операционной системы.

Преодоление ограничений

Если вам необходимо загрузить файл, который превышает ограничение на сервере или на клиенте, вам может понадобиться применить специальные методы для преодоления этих ограничений. Например, вы можете разделить файл на несколько более маленьких частей и загрузить их последовательно.

Также вы можете обратиться к администратору сервера или поставщику услуг для увеличения ограничения на загрузку файлов. В некоторых случаях, при настройке сервера, ограничение можно изменить или отключить полностью.

Ограничения на загрузку файлов могут быть установлены как на сервере, так и на клиенте, и их значения могут различаться в зависимости от используемой платформы. Важно знать эти ограничения, чтобы успешно загружать файлы на разных платформах.

Ошибки при загрузке больших файлов

Загрузка файлов является неотъемлемой частью работы с интернет-ресурсами. Однако, при попытке загрузить файлы большого размера, могут возникнуть различные ошибки. Давайте рассмотрим некоторые из них и попытаемся понять, как с ними справиться.

1. Ошибка размера файла

Одной из наиболее распространенных ошибок при загрузке больших файлов является ошибка размера файла. В большинстве случаев это связано с ограничениями, установленными на сервере или веб-приложении, к которому происходит загрузка.

Веб-серверы и хостинг-провайдеры часто ограничивают максимальный размер загружаемых файлов, чтобы снизить нагрузку на сервер и защитить от возможных угроз безопасности. Если попытаться загрузить файл, размер которого превышает установленное ограничение, сервер может вернуть ошибку и отказаться от загрузки файла.

2. Проблемы со временем ожидания

Загрузка больших файлов требует дополнительного времени и ресурсов. Иногда, при попытке загрузить файл большого размера, может возникнуть проблема с временем ожидания. Это может быть связано с ограничениями таймаута, установленными на сервере или клиентском устройстве.

Если загрузка файла занимает слишком много времени и превышает установленное ограничение, сервер или клиент могут прекратить процесс загрузки и вернуть ошибку. В таком случае, можно попробовать увеличить время ожидания или разбить файл на несколько более мелких частей для более удобной загрузки.

3. Недостаточно свободного пространства на диске

Еще одна возможноя причина ошибок при загрузке больших файлов — недостаток свободного пространства на диске. Если на сервере или клиентском устройстве недостаточно места для сохранения загружаемого файла, то загрузка может быть прервана и возникнет ошибка.

Перед загрузкой большого файла, убедитесь, что на диске достаточно свободного места для хранения файла. При необходимости, освободите место, удалив ненужные файлы или переместив их на другой носитель.

4. Проблемы с соединением

Неустойчивое или медленное интернет-соединение также может вызвать ошибку при загрузке больших файлов. При попытке загрузить файл через нестабильное соединение, связь может быть прервана и процесс загрузки прерван.

Если вы столкнулись с проблемами при загрузке больших файлов, попробуйте проверить качество и стабильность вашего интернет-соединения. Если возможно, подключитесь к более стабильной сети или используйте проводное соединение.

Ошибка при загрузке больших файлов может быть вызвана различными причинами, включая ограничения по размеру файла, проблемы со временем ожидания, недостаток свободного пространства на диске и проблемы с соединением. Перед загрузкой большого файла, необходимо учитывать эти возможные проблемы и принимать необходимые меры для их решения или предотвращения.

Какие ошибки могут возникать?

При загрузке файла, размер которого превышает 4 МБ, могут возникать различные ошибки, связанные с ограничениями на размер файла на сервере или веб-приложении. Вот некоторые из возможных ошибок:

1. Ошибка 413: Запрос слишком большой

Ошибка 413 (Payload Too Large) возникает, когда размер файла превышает ограничение, установленное на сервере или веб-приложении для максимального размера загружаемых файлов. В результате сервер отклоняет запрос, поскольку он не может обработать файл такого большого размера.

2. Ошибка 404: Файл не найден

Ошибка 404 (Not Found) может возникнуть, когда сервер не может найти файл, который вы пытаетесь загрузить. Это может произойти, если путь к файлу указан неверно или если файл был удален или перемещен.

3. Ошибка 500: Внутренняя ошибка сервера

Ошибка 500 (Internal Server Error) может возникнуть, когда происходит непредвиденная ошибка на сервере при попытке обработать загружаемый файл. Это может быть связано с неправильной настройкой сервера или ошибкой в программном коде.

4. Ошибка 403: Доступ запрещен

Ошибка 403 (Forbidden) может возникнуть, если у вас нет прав на загрузку файлов указанного размера. Это может быть вызвано ограничениями безопасности или настройками, предотвращающими загрузку файлов большого размера.

5. Ошибка 408: Время ожидания истекло

Ошибка 408 (Request Timeout) может возникнуть, когда сервер не может обработать запрос на загрузку файла за отведенное время. Это может произойти, если сервер загружен или сетевое соединение между клиентом и сервером нестабильно.

При возникновении любой из этих ошибок, важно проверить настройки сервера и веб-приложения, а также убедиться, что файл не превышает установленные ограничения. Если проблема не устраняется, рекомендуется обратиться к системному администратору или технической поддержке для получения дополнительной помощи.

КАК ЗАГРУЗИТЬ ГИФКУ? I ОШИБКА 8 МБ! I DeviantArt I ТУТОРИАЛ I РЕШЕНИЕ I

Как определить, что ошибка связана с размером файла?

При загрузке файла на веб-сервер может возникнуть ошибка, связанная с его размером. Это особенно актуально, когда загружается файл, размер которого превышает 4 МБ (мегабайта), так как многие серверы имеют ограничение на максимальный размер файла, который можно загрузить.

Если вы столкнулись с проблемой загрузки файла и подозреваете, что она связана с его размером, есть несколько способов определить, является ли это именно причиной проблемы:

  1. Узнайте ограничения сервера: Важно понять, какой максимальный размер файла разрешен на вашем сервере. Для этого можно обратиться к администратору хостинга или изучить документацию. Если файл превышает это ограничение, то это может быть причиной ошибки.
  2. Проверьте размер файла: Перед загрузкой файла на сервер убедитесь, что его размер не превышает допустимого лимита. Для этого можно использовать специальные инструменты или методы, доступные в программе, с помощью которой происходит загрузка файла.
  3. Попробуйте загрузить другие файлы: Если при загрузке файла большого размера возникает ошибка, а при загрузке других файлов маленького размера — нет, то это может свидетельствовать о проблеме, связанной именно с размером файла.

Если после проведения этих проверок вы все же считаете, что проблема связана с размером файла, вам необходимо принять соответствующие меры. Это может включать в себя сжатие файла до приемлемого размера, разделение файла на более мелкие части или обращение к администратору сервера для изменения ограничений на загрузку файлов.

Рейтинг
( Пока оценок нет )
Загрузка ...